Primal Philly Cheesesteak in a Bowl

Ingredients
- 1 lb. skirt steak, sliced thinly
- 2 green peppers, sliced thinly
- 2 yellow onions, sliced thinly
- 8 oz. mushrooms, sliced
- 4 oz. good melting cheese (I used raw milk Colby), sliced
- 2 T butter
- 1 T Worcestershire sauce
- 1 T hot sauce
- S&P

Preparation
Step 1
Put your oven on broil and place the rack in the middle of the oven. In a large, oven proof saucepan, melt the butter over high heat and add hot sauce and Worcestershire sauce. Brown the beef really well. Seriously. Get a nice brown crust on each piece. Add the onions, peppers and mushrooms. Place a lid/cover on the saute pan and stir occasionally while the peppers and onions soften. Once that’s happened, top with cheese slices, stick the pan under the broiler until the cheese has reached the desired melty-ness stage. Some like it gooey and some like it brown and bubbly. Take it out of the oven and serve.
